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Booted Eagle | Madeiran Pipistrelle |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Accipitriformes (Hawks & Eagles)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Accipitridae (Hawks & Eagles) | Vespertilionidae |
| Genus | Hieraaetus | Pipistrellus |
| Species | Hieraaetus pennatus | Pipistrellus maderensis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Booted Eagle and Madeiran Pipistrelle share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
